This year is the 60th anniversary of the Eurovision Song Contest.
Michael and Mark take a trip down memory lane and try to squeeze 60 years of Eurovision history into under 60 minutes of radio magic.
From Australians in Eurovision and the fun of the interval act to GLBTIQ performers and what happens when you name products in your songs, the boys dig up the archives to present an hour of Eurovision history.
Plus, news about Guy Sebastian’s lack of Eurovision airplay in Australia.
The Playlist
Lys Assia – Refrain (1956 – Switzerland: 1st place) ![]()
Olivia Newton-John – Long Live Love (AU: 1974 – UK: 4th place) ![]()
Ofra Haza – Hi (1983 – Israel: 2nd place) ![]()
Lotta Engberg – Fyra Bugg & en Coca-Cola [Boogaloo] (1987 – Sweden: 12th place) ![]()
MeKaDo – Wir geben ‘ne Party (1994 – Germany: 3rd place) ![]()
Dana International – Diva (GLBTIQ: 1998 – Israel: 1st place) ![]()
Sestre – Samo Ljubezen (GLBTIQ: 2002 – Slovenia: 13th place) ![]()
Kate Ryan – Je T’Adore (2006 – Belgium: 26th place [12th in Semi Final]) ![]()
Jedward – Lipstick (2011 – Ireland: 8th place) ![]()
Conchita Wurst – Rise Like A Phoenix (2014 – Austria: 1st place) ![]()
